Rodriguez has stopped all three of his opponents inside of two rounds.<\/p>\n<p class=\"duet--article--dangerously-set-cms-markup duet--article--standard-paragraph _1nfb3k4i _16w9vov1 _16w9vov0 ls9zuh1\">Sandhagen has followed Rodriguez\u2019s MMA journey from the very beginning, and recognized he was special immediately. In fact, Sandhagen believes Rodriguez is ready for the big show right now.<\/p>\n<p class=\"duet--article--dangerously-set-cms-markup duet--article--standard-paragraph _1nfb3k4i _16w9vov1 _16w9vov0 ls9zuh1\">\u201cI love Elias, me and Elias are good friends now,\u201d Sandhagen told MMA Fighting. \u201cI think we started training a lot together probably around COVID times, just because we\u2019re only allowed to have a certain amount of training partners and I\u2019ve kind of always done a really good job in my career of like figuring out which young fighter is pretty talented, but also is going to be at the gym as much as me and all of that stuff, because those guys are pretty easy to get really good, really quick. Instead of having to bounce around and go to 1,000 gyms, I\u2019d rather just make the people around me really good.<\/p>\n<p class=\"duet--article--dangerously-set-cms-markup duet--article--standard-paragraph _1nfb3k4i _16w9vov1 _16w9vov0 ls9zuh1\">\u201cAround COVID time is when we weren\u2019t allowed to have a lot of training partners and that\u2019s when me and Elias really started training together a good chunk of time. He was still really young then \u2013 probably still like maybe 18 or 19 or 20, or something around then. But yeah, that\u2019s when we started training and he\u2019s become an absolute killer.I want to get him in the UFC this year. I think that he could easily be, I know that things move really quick and things happen or whatever, but I could easily see him in the top-five, top-10 in the UFC sometime in 2028.<\/p>\n<p class=\"duet--article--dangerously-set-cms-markup duet--article--standard-paragraph _1nfb3k4i _16w9vov1 _16w9vov0 ls9zuh1\">\u201cHe\u2019s incredible, man. I think he\u2019s going to go all the way with this thing and I\u2019m pumped to just be there for it. So it\u2019s cool and I got a really good training partner to train with. He\u2019s one of the few guys that I feel like I go with that can really whip my ass if I don\u2019t show up, and even when I do show up on that day, now I feel like he sometimes gets the better of me still. So it\u2019s cool to have someone that can push me in that way too and it\u2019s cool that it\u2019s him, because I felt like I got to just play a small part in making him that good.\u201d<\/p>\n<p class=\"duet--article--dangerously-set-cms-markup duet--article--standard-paragraph _1nfb3k4i _16w9vov1 _16w9vov0 ls9zuh1\">Rodriguez was a wrestler and jiu-jitsu practitioner growing up, but it wasn\u2019t until he was in his late teens where the idea of being an MMA fighter became a thing. After going 5-0 as an amateur \u2014 which includes winning and defending a regional title \u2014 it was time to make the transition to the pro ranks.<\/p>\n<p class=\"duet--article--dangerously-set-cms-markup duet--article--standard-paragraph _1nfb3k4i _16w9vov1 _16w9vov0 ls9zuh1\">With a pair of knockouts and a submission under his belt during his 3-0 start in LFA, Rodriguez reflects on his journey through the sport, and with Sandhagen as one of his training partners.<\/p>\n<p class=\"duet--article--dangerously-set-cms-markup duet--article--standard-paragraph _1nfb3k4i _16w9vov1 _16w9vov0 ls9zuh1\">\u201cI remember the first time I ever MMA sparred was against Cory and Justin Wetzel, who fights in the PFL now, and it was during COVID time. I was like 19, and they whooped my ass so bad. They weren\u2019t even trying. I got dropped to the body so many times. I thought I was nasty.<\/p>\n<p class=\"duet--article--dangerously-set-cms-markup duet--article--standard-paragraph _1nfb3k4i _16w9vov1 _16w9vov0 ls9zuh1\">\u201cAnd now just to hear him say that and how far we\u2019ve come where I was undefeated in my career, I\u2019m still undefeated as a pro, I\u2019m going to remain undefeated this weekend, it\u2019s just nice to kind of hear that progress has been coming to fruition and it\u2019s starting to come to a head now. So it\u2019s really great to hear from Cory.\u201d<\/p>\n<p class=\"duet--article--dangerously-set-cms-markup duet--article--standard-paragraph _1nfb3k4i _16w9vov1 _16w9vov0 ls9zuh1\">When asked who he would compare Rodriguez to that\u2019s currently in the UFC, Sandhagen was nearly at a loss for words, seeing Rodriguez as a fighter who came into the gym with a mirroring mentality to establishing a style that\u2019s unique to only him.<\/p>\n<p class=\"duet--article--dangerously-set-cms-markup duet--article--standard-paragraph _1nfb3k4i _16w9vov1 _16w9vov0 ls9zuh1\">As Rodriguez\u2019s striking game continues to evolve, he compares it to one of the most vicious knockout artists \u2014and one of the few two-division champions \u2014 the UFC has seen.<\/p>\n<p class=\"duet--article--dangerously-set-cms-markup duet--article--standard-paragraph _1nfb3k4i _16w9vov1 _16w9vov0 ls9zuh1\">\u201cI think he kind of punches like [Alex] Pereira, I guess \u2013 like the, the types of things that he does,\u201d Sandhagen said. \u201cBut he fights a little bit lower to the floor and, obviously, it\u2019s a different weight class, so he has to be a little bit more mobile and he\u2019s a little bit faster. But I would say that his striking is, I guess, a little bit like that in the way that he punches, and then the way that he defends himself too.<\/p>\n<p class=\"duet--article--dangerously-set-cms-markup duet--article--standard-paragraph _1nfb3k4i _16w9vov1 _16w9vov0 ls9zuh1\">\u201cBut in grappling, I don\u2019t really know that he\u2019s like too many other people. He\u2019s kind of like any 25-year-old gangly guy in that he\u2019ll whip around and make his body do shit that might break my back but won\u2019t break his. So he kind of has that style of jiu-jitsu, it\u2019s kind of a tangly style of jiu-jitsu versus maybe a raw-strength, power-through-someone type of jiu-jitsu. And yeah, I don\u2019t really know who I would compare it to in the UFC that I think would do it justice because Elias is a super good grappler. But, man,I\u2019m telling you right now, when he gets into the UFC just because of the way that he fights and because of the level of opponents that he\u2019s grown up sparring against and stuff like that, it\u2019s not going to be long until the entire UFC, and big portions of the world are going to know about him, because he has that style that\u2019s fun to watch, and the dude likes getting finishes too.\u201d<\/p>\n<p class=\"duet--article--dangerously-set-cms-markup duet--article--standard-paragraph _1nfb3k4i _16w9vov1 _16w9vov0 ls9zuh1\">Rodriguez is not a fighter who feels he needs more experience before he makes his mark in the UFC. In fact, if the UFC called him right now for a short-notice fight, he would jump on the opportunity.<\/p>\n<p class=\"duet--article--dangerously-set-cms-markup duet--article--standard-paragraph _1nfb3k4i _16w9vov1 _16w9vov0 ls9zuh1\">First things first, Rodriguez has an opportunity to open more eyes as he competes for LFA for the fourth time \u2014 an organization that has become one of the UFC\u2019s top feeder promotions.<\/p>\n<p class=\"duet--article--dangerously-set-cms-markup duet--article--standard-paragraph _1nfb3k4i _16w9vov1 _16w9vov0 ls9zuh1\">\u201cI think I can beat people in the UFC for sure,\u201d Rodriguez said. \u201c100 percent, I know I can do that. I think I know how big of a fish I am in the ponds, and I got to work my way up as much as I need to do that, but I know this: I watched the fights, I watched the 45ers. I watched the guys at the top and I know I can beat those guys.\u201d<\/p>\n","protected":false},"excerpt":{"rendered":"Cory Sandhagen doesn\u2019t train with just anybody, and he sees something special in Elias Rodriguez.
